What Is AAMA 501.2 Spray Rack Testing? re

AAMA 501.2 is a field testing standard developed by the American Architectural Manufacturers Association (AAMA). It is specifically designed to evaluate the water-tightness of installed windows, curtain walls, and storefront systems.

Unlike laboratory testing, AAMA 501.2 Testing in Tampa focuses on real-world installation conditions. It uses a calibrated spray rack system to apply water to the exterior of the building, simulating wind-driven rain.

This process is a key part of Window Testing in Tampa and helps identify whether the installation not just the product meets performance expectations.

How Spray Rack Testing Works

During Spray Rack Testing in Tampa, a series of spray nozzles are positioned outside the window or façade system. Water is sprayed at a controlled rate while the interior is observed for signs of leakage.

Key aspects of the test include:

  • Consistent water flow rate to simulate rainfall
  • Targeted application at joints, seams, and connections
  • Visual inspection inside the building for leaks

Unlike other forms of Water Penetration Testing in Tampa, AAMA 501.2 does not rely on pressure chambers. Instead, it focuses on detecting installation flaws under realistic conditions.

Common Installation Failures Detected

One of the biggest advantages of AAMA 501.2 Testing in Tampa is its ability to pinpoint installation-related issues. Common failures include:

  • Improper sealant application
  • Gaps around window frames
  • Poor flashing installation
  • Incomplete air and water barrier connections
  • Defective transitions between materials

These issues often go unnoticed during visual inspections but are easily detected during Water Penetration Testing in Tampa.

How AAMA 501.2 Differs from Other Testing Standards

While AAMA 501.2 Testing in Tampa is highly effective, it is typically used alongside other standards to provide a complete evaluation of window performance.

Common related standards include:

  • ASTM E1105 in Tampa– Field testing for water penetration under pressure
  • ASTM E783 in Tampa – Air leakage testing of installed windows
  • ASTM E547 in Tampa – Laboratory water penetration testing
  • ASTM E331 in Tampa – Static pressure water penetration testing
  • AAMA 502 & 503 in Tampa – Quality assurance testing for installed systems

Together, these standards form a comprehensive approach to Window Testing in Tampa and overall building performance.

When Should Spray Rack Testing Be Performed?

Spray Rack Testing in Tampa is typically conducted:

  • During new construction (quality assurance)
  • After window installation is complete
  • Before final inspections
  • When leaks are suspected in existing buildings

Early testing allows issues to be corrected before they lead to major damage or failed inspections.
